Israeli photographer captured paragliders and attacks moments before Hamas killed him

Here are the last images taken by Israeli photographer Gilad Kfir, minutes before he was shot dead by Hamas terrorists on October 7.

Starting at 7:40 a.m., Kfir, a resident of Nativ HaAsarah, photographed the terrorists paragliding toward Israel during the surprise attack, part of Hamas’ campaign using land, air and sea to breach the border.

Gilad Kfir was killed shortly after photographing Palestinian terrorists paragliding into Israel on October 7. Kfir took 65 photographs between 8:16 and 8:17, capturing Hamas rockets intercepted by Iron Dome, Israel’s missile defense system.

In total, Kfir took about 86 photographs that morning.

His partner gave birth to their daughter on Wednesday.
